Programming and Customizing the Multicore Propeller : Microcontroller the Official Guide, Paperback by Avery, Shane; Gracey, Chip; Graner, Vern; Hebel, Martin; Hintze, Joshua, ISBN 0071664505, ISBN-13 9780071664509, Like New Used, Free shipping in the US This guide to using the multicore Propeller microcontroller chip starts with a review of the Propeller chip's architecture, the Spin programming language, debugging techniques, and sensor interfacing. The rest of th gives step-by-step directions for eight applications, including a balancing robot, and the use of the Propeller chip as a virtual peripheral for media applications. The final application is a speech synthesis demonstration written by the inventor of the Propeller chip. Th includes b&w screenshots, photos of equipment, and process illustrations on every page. The software, documentation, example code, and other resources cited in th are available for free . Annotation ©2010 Book News, Inc., Portland, OR ()
